Qt
Ace_stu
C、C++小白
展开
-
Qt银行管理项目——CS构架
——以此纪念过年我在家里做的第一个项目1.CS框架(1)server服务器端创建myserverwindow类(ui界面),专用于serverTCP连接myserverwindow.h#ifndef MYSERVERWINDOW_H#define MYSERVERWINDOW_H#include <QMainWindow>#include <QTcpServer>#incl...原创 2018-02-21 00:13:50 · 2288 阅读 · 2 评论 -
Qt银行管理系统——初始界面功能函数_登录
2.功能函数(1)登录客户端创建login设计师类,登录功能函数在所有功能函数中为最复杂,因为登录是初始界面,需要连接服务器,需要发送数据给服务器,让服务器连接上数据库,并判断账号密码是否有效,然后执行接下来的所有功能都建立在这和连接套接字上。login.h#ifndef LOGIN_H#define LOGIN_H#include <QWidget>#include "cilent....原创 2018-02-21 00:47:33 · 2250 阅读 · 0 评论 -
Qt银行管理系统——初始界面功能函数_其他
2.功能函数(2)其他功能函数另外所有功能函数的过程都大差不差,所以我总结其中一个功能函数,那就选查询余额,因为查询余额稍微复杂一些些,毕竟要返回余额到客户端客户端新建一个类balance来存放balance.h#ifndef BALANCE_H#define BALANCE_H#include <QWidget>#include <QDialog>namespace Ui...原创 2018-02-21 01:07:48 · 788 阅读 · 0 评论 -
Qt银行管理系统——全局变量extern的使用
网上有两个方法,别人并不建议用extern因为会影响封装性。都建议用static关键字新建一个类然后放到public中去,然后我用了extern,因为简单方便,static用了一下没用的上来。1.首先也是要创建一个lei来存放全局变量,我创建了一个类share,在类中申明extern变量,注意不要定义,只要申明,因为只能定义一次的。share.h#ifndef SHARE_H#define SHA...原创 2018-02-21 01:21:01 · 952 阅读 · 0 评论